Events:
2 Man Ambrose; Two Ball Best Ball; Championships; Stableford Competition
Notes:
- Open to NZ Golf affiliated players with a NZ Golf Handicap Index or International equivalent
- 2 Man Ambrose: Mixed, men or women pairs teams. 18 Hole competition. Gross and Nett competitions in equal divisions by handicap in each category. Best 3 in each division receive medals
- Two Ball Best Ball: Mixed, men or women pairs teams. 18 Hole Competition. Gross and Nett competitions in equal divisions by combined handicap. Best 3 in each division receive medals
- Championships: Men / women 18 Holes. Aggregate score for 2 days qualify for medals. Medals in age groups as shown in competitor list. Gross competition in each division. Nett competitions in equal divisions by handicap. Score will also qualify for the daily Stableford competition, which Championship participants are automatically entered into. Medals depending on number of competitors in each age group – gold, silver and bronze for more than 10 competitors. Gold or silver for 4-9 competitors. Gold only for 3 or less
- Stableford: Individual competitions each day. Enabling entries by individuals who are only able to play on one of the days. Only enter if you are not entering the Championships but still want to play one day
